About 14 Queens Road
14 Queens Road is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Leigh On Sea (SS9 1BA). It has a recorded floor area of 66 m² (around 710 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2014)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 3-band jump. The latest certificate is from July 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
6 planning records sit against the property, 3 approved, 3 refused. Past consents include new windows and an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 66 m² it's 26.7%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(90 m² median across 16 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 75% of similar EPCs). Across 1996–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 7%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£676/sq ft) was about 167.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: September 2023 at £480,000.
